Invention Grant
- Patent Title: Compressed ray direction data in a ray tracing system
-
Application No.: US16375648Application Date: 2019-04-04
-
Publication No.: US10769842B2Publication Date: 2020-09-08
- Inventor: Luke T. Peterson , Simon Fenney
- Applicant: Imagination Technologies Limited
- Applicant Address: GB Kings Langley
- Assignee: Imagination Technologies Limited
- Current Assignee: Imagination Technologies Limited
- Current Assignee Address: GB Kings Langley
- Agency: Potomac Law Group, PLLC
- Agent Vincent M DeLuca
- Main IPC: G06T15/06
- IPC: G06T15/06 ; G06T15/55 ; G06T15/30 ; G06T9/00 ; G06T15/50

Abstract:
Ray tracing systems process rays through a 3D scene to determine intersections between rays and geometry in the scene, for rendering an image of the scene. Ray direction data for a ray can be compressed, e.g. into an octahedral vector format. The compressed ray direction data for a ray may be represented by two parameters (u,v) which indicate a point on the surface of an octahedron. In order to perform intersection testing on the ray, the ray direction data for the ray is unpacked to determine x, y and z components of a vector to a point on the surface of the octahedron. The unpacked ray direction vector is an unnormalised ray direction vector. Rather than normalising the ray direction vector, the intersection testing is performed on the unnormalised ray direction vector. This avoids the processing steps involved in normalising the ray direction vector.
Public/Granted literature
- US20190236833A1 Compressed Ray Direction Data in a Ray Tracing System Public/Granted day:2019-08-01
Information query
IPC分类:
G | 物理 |
G06 | 计算;推算或计数 |
G06T | 一般的图像数据处理或产生 |
G06T15/00 | 3D〔三维〕图像的加工 |
G06T15/06 | .光线跟踪 |